Nedir.Org
Soru Tara Cevapla Giriş


Cevap Ara?

14.756.348 den fazla soru içinde arama yap.

Sorunu Tarat
Kitaptan resmini çek hemen cevaplansın.

Serilog nedir

Serilog nedir sorusunun cevabı için bana yardımcı olur musunuz?

Bu soruya 2 cevap yazıldı. Cevap İçin Alta Doğru İlerleyin.
    Şikayet Et Bu soruya 0 yorum yazıldı.

    İşte Cevaplar


    Zeus

    • 2023-12-08 07:50:39

    Cevap :

    Serilog, .NET uygulamaları için bir yapısal loglama kütüphanesidir. Serilog, .NET Core, .NET Framework, Mono ve Xamarin için kullanılabilir.

    Serilog, aşağıdaki özellikleri sunar:

    1. Yapısal loglama: Serilog, logları JSON, XML veya CSV gibi yapısal formatlarda kaydeder. Bu, logları analiz etmeyi ve anlamayı kolaylaştırır.
    2. Çoklu çıkış: Serilog, logları birden çok çıkışa kaydedebilir. Örneğin, logları hem konsola hem de bir dosyaya kaydedebilirsiniz.
    3. Filtreleme: Serilog, logları filtreleyerek belirli olayları veya bilgileri kaydetmeyi veya kaydetmemeyi seçebilirsiniz.
    4. Seviyelendirme: Serilog, logları önem düzeyine göre (örneğin, bilgi, uyarı, hata) kategorize edebilir.
    5. Etkinleştirme: Serilog, logları uygulamanın belirli bölümlerinde etkinleştirebilir veya devre dışı bırakabilirsiniz.

    Serilog, .NET uygulamaları için kapsamlı ve güçlü bir loglama çözümü sunar.

    Serilog'u kullanmaya başlamak için, aşağıdaki adımları izleyin:

    1. Serilog nuget paketini projenize ekleyin.
    2. Serilog'u uygulamanızdaki kodunuzda yapılandırın.
    3. Loglama API'sini kullanarak logları kaydedin.

    Serilog'u nasıl kullanacağınıza dair daha fazla bilgi için, Serilog belgelerine bakabilirsiniz.

    Serilog'un bazı kullanım örnekleri şunlardır:

    1. Uygulamanın performansını izlemek için loglama kullanılabilir.
    2. Uygulamada meydana gelen hataları izlemek için loglama kullanılabilir.
    3. Kullanıcı davranışını izlemek için loglama kullanılabilir.

    Serilog, .NET uygulamaları için loglamayı kolay ve verimli hale getirmeye yardımcı olur.



    Diğer Cevaplara Gözat
    Cevap Yaz Arama Yap

    Zeus

    • 2023-12-08 07:50:53

    Cevap :

    Serilog, .NET uygulamaları için popüler bir loglama kütüphanesidir. 2013 yılında yayınlanmıştır ve loglama işlemlerini basitleştiren bir üçüncü taraf kütüphanedir. Serilog, yapılandırılmış loglama (structured logging) özelliğiyle diğer kütüphanelerden ayrılır.

    Klasik loglama genellikle mesaj ve değer olmak üzere iki bileşenden oluşurken, yapılandırılmış loglama yapısal verileri loglamak ve bu verileri kolayca sorgulamak için kullanılır. Serilog, mesaj şablonları (message template) oluşturmayı ve loglama sırasında bu şablonları parametre olarak kullanmayı sağlar. Bu şekilde oluşturulan şablonlar, filtreleme, sıralama, serileştirme gibi işlemlerde büyük bir yardımcı olur ve etkili bir loglama süreci sağlar.

    Serilog, çeşitli hedeflere (sink) logları kaydedebilir. Bu hedefler arasında konsol, veritabanı, dosya gibi birçok ortam bulunur. Serilog, kayıt işlemini gerçekleştirdiği ortamları "Sink" olarak nitelendirir ve Serilog.Sinks isim alanı altında toplar.

    Serilog, yapılandırması kolay, kolayca uygulanabilir ve güçlü filtreleme özelliği gibi özelliklere sahip bir loglama kütüphanesidir. Ayrıca yapılandırılmış olay verilerini destekler ve açık kaynak kodlu bir kütüphanedir.

    Cevap Yaz Arama Yap

    Cevap Yaz




    Başarılı

    İşleminiz başarıyla kaydedilmiştir.